**Ticket PRQ-4421: Proctoring queue drops candidates after reconnect**

Environment: Vantley Proctor staging.

Steps:
1. Enroll a test candidate in the Ashcombe mock exam.
2. Join the proctor queue, then drop the network for 30 seconds.
3. Reconnect; the candidate is removed from the queue without audit entry.

Expected: position retained and event logged. To replay the queue API calls against staging, use the token below.

session JWT of yawep-yawep = eyJhbGciOiJIUzI1NiIsInR5cCI6IkpXVCJ9.eyJzdWIiOiI3pWF3_In0.aXYsHiog

## Sensor drift: what to do at 3am

If the GrowLoop controller starts reporting humidity swings that don't match the backup probes in the Fernwick greenhouse, it's almost always sensor drift, not an actual climate event. Don't panic and don't touch the vents manually. First, restart the calibration daemon and give it ten minutes to re-baseline. If readings still disagree by more than 5%, flip the controller into safe mode. The safe-mode thresholds it will use are these.

config for yahap-bajof:
[istix]
host = istix.qorvelsys.internal
user = istix_svc
database = istix_prod

Visitors must never use the goods lift at Tarnwick Court — it is reserved for deliveries handled by Pellory Logistics staff. New starters escorting couriers should route them via dock B. Escort visitors by the main lifts only. If you must operate the goods lift yourself, enter the code shown below.

staff pass of kawip-hawef = bdg-QLP-2

Manager Wiki — Hiring Freeze: Crestline Division

Restricted to managers. Effective immediately, all open requisitions in the Crestline division at Ostermark Goods are paused pending the cost review led by the Pellway office. Backfills require VP sign-off. Sales leads should not discuss the freeze with candidates or partners. The rationale is covered in the confidential note below.

confidential, kagup-bafog: Fraaxax Group is in early talks to buy Soroxox Group for about $343.8 million. The Olidor launch date is June 14, and nothing goes to the press before then. Legal wants the Aldmirek Logistics term sheet signed before July 23.